2019-00502 Bayview Loan Servicing, LLC, respondent, v Belle Lind Tuchinsky Gayer, appellant, et al., defendants. (Index No. 7111/2016)
| ORDER TO SHOW CAUSE |
Appeal from an order and judgment (one paper) of the Supreme Court, Nassau County, entered October 31, 2018. By decision and order on motion of this Court dated January 7, 2020, the branch of a motion by the respondent which was to dismiss the appeal was denied on condition that on or before February 7, 2020, the appellant serve and file a supplemental record containing the affidavit of Mymamar Colon, dated October 25, 2017, with annexed exhibits. The appellant has failed to serve and file a supplement record.
On the Court's own motion, it is
ORDERED that the parties to the appeal are directed to show cause before this Court why an order should or should not be made and entered dismissing the appeal on the ground that the appellant failed to serve and file a supplemental record containing the affidavit of Mymamar Colon, dated October 25, 2017, with annexed exhibits, by uploading a digital copy of an affirmation or an affidavit, with proof of service thereof, through the digital portal on this Court's website, on or before August 28, 2020; and it is further,
ORDERED that the Clerk of the Court, or her designee, shall serve a copy of this order to show cause upon the parties to the appeal via email to the email address provided to this Court, or, if no email address is available for service, by regular mail.
SCHEINKMAN, P.J., MASTRO, RIVERA, DILLON and BALKIN, JJ., concur.
